Each tie is handmade of the finest and some of the most unusual materials..

Each necktie is hand-silkscreened onto a 100% charmeuse silk or microfiber tie; the microfiber is a rich, soft fabric resembling silk. Charmeuse silk is a much more expensive and elegant soft silk, smooth with a slight sheen to it. Silk ties should only be dry-cleaned, never washed! The microfiber can be gently spot or hand washed and dried flat as the screenprinted design is heat-set for durability. Dry-cleaning is still recommeded for all ties to increase their lifespan.
